Greek For 2228
Word e
Pronunciation ay
Definition a primary particle of distinction between two connected terms; disjunctive, or; comparative, than:

and, but (either), (n-)either, except it be, (n-)or (else), rather, save, than, that, what, yea. Often used in connection with other particles. Compare especially 2235, 2260, 2273.
Root(s) 2235  2260  2273
